Chicago Blackhawks forward Marian Hossa made NHL history Tuesday night, scoring his 500th career goal with a second-period tally versus the Philadelphia Flyers.
Hossa, well on his way to the Hockey Hall of Fame, is the 44th player in league history to accomplish the feat.
